BZA420A

Quadruple ESD transient voltage suppressor

Monolithic transient voltage suppressor diode in a six lead SOT457 (SC-74) package for 4-bit wide ESD transient suppression at 20 V level.

Features and benefits

  • ESD rating >8 kV, according to IEC1000-4-2

  • SOT457 surface mount package

  • Common anode configuration

  • Non-clamping range −0.5 to 20 V

  • Maximum reverse peak power dissipation: 19.6 W at tp = 1 ms

  • Maximum clamping voltage at peak pulse current: 28 V at Izsm = 0.7 A

Applications

  • Computers and peripherals

  • Audio and video equipment

  • Communication systems

  • Medical equipment
